[0025] Example 1

[0026] A motor I 6 is installed on the base 4, and the motor I is connected to the platform 3 through the eccentric rocker arm 9. The platform 3 is provided with a motor II 7 and a counterweight 5, and the motor II is connected to the bottle body 2 through a chain. A fixing frame for fixing the bottle body 2; the fixing frame is composed of a chuck 1 and a tail top 8.

[0027] Taking a small-caliber gas cylinder as an example, the rust removal method of the present invention includes the following steps:

[0028] Fill the bottle to be processed with high-hardness abrasives and liquids, and use the tail top and chuck to fix the bottle; when the motor II works, the bottle is driven by the chain to rotate; the abrasive in the bottle rotates by gravity and the bottle When the motor I rotates, the eccentric rocker arm drives the platform to swing up and down, which drives the bottle to swing, and the abrasive in the bottle also produces relative movement. Abstract

The invention relates to a finishing rust removal device and method for liners. The device and the method are used for removing rust on the inner surfaces of bottles of aerospace gas path systems. According to the structure of the device, a motor I is mounted on a base and connected with a platform through a transmission unit I, a motor II is mounted on the platform and connected with a bottle body through a transmission unit II, and a fixing frame for fixing the bottle body is arranged above the platform. According to the device and the method, a finishing rust removal technology is used, and rust removal is achieved through grinding of grinding materials and the inner surface of the bottle body, so that corrosion substances in the cavity of the inner surface of the bottle body are effectively removed, problems of hydrogen embrittlement caused by acid pickling and uncompleted cleaning of local corrosion of sand blasting are solved, and the high generalization performance is provided for the inner surface rust removal of bottle bodies.

Description

technical field [0001] The invention relates to a device and a method for removing rust on the inner surface of equipment, in particular to an inner tank light decoration rust removal device and a rust removal method for removing rust on the inner surface of a bottle of an aerospace gas path system. Background technique [0002] At present, the rust removal of the inner surface of the gas cylinder in the aerospace gas system has always been a technical problem in the field, especially the rust removal of the inner surface of the irregularly shaped bottle is not easy to operate. The rust removal methods in the prior art are mainly sandblasting and pickling, but the above methods have their limitations. Sandblasting the inner tank of the bottle is prone to blind spots, resulting in the problem that the rust cannot be removed. Pickling is forbidden for strong steel.
